To those of u who knows a bit about famous Go players, don't u find it a bit weird that they don't ever mention Go Seigen? Shusaku is generally recognized as the best of the 19th century, and Seigen for the 20th.
Also the idea of the "Hand of God" is unrealistic, since there isn't really a set of perfect moves as your moves really depend on your opponent move as well. |
